What Are China Heat Resistant Steel Products?

Simply put, these are specialized steel alloys produced in China engineered to maintain strength and shape in high-temperature environments without cracking or deforming. Unlike standard carbon steels, these contain elements like chromium, molybdenum, and sometimes nickel to boost heat durability.

They’re used widely where safety and reliability matter—hot pipelines, power plants, automotive exhausts, and even military equipment. In humanitarian contexts, such steels ensure durable shelter frameworks in extreme climates, thus connecting industrial innovation with social needs.

Core Components & Key Factors

Durability Against Thermal Fatigue

The foremost trait is thermal fatigue resistance — the ability to repeatedly endure temperature swings without cracking. The chromium and molybdenum in the alloy form protective layers that stop oxidation and brittleness.

Corrosion Resistance

High temperatures often accelerate corrosion, especially in chemical plants and refineries. China’s heat resistant steels have enhanced corrosion resistance, extending equipment lifespan significantly versus traditional steels.

Challenges and How the Industry is Addressing Them

It’s not all smooth sailing. Heat resistant steels can be tricky to weld or machine, requiring specialized skills. Plus, quality variability remains a concern, especially from lesser-known producers.

But many well-established Chinese vendors now offer certifications and custom tech support, sometimes partnering with international labs for testing. Investment in R&D to improve alloy formulas is steady, which should iron out current issues within a few years.
